
Join the World Literature Book Group as they discuss Cosmos by Witold Gombrowicz. A recipient of the 1967 International Price for Literature, this celebrated work is translated from Polish to English by Danuta Borchardt. In Cosmos, a despondent student encounters a series of bizarre events when traveling to a family-run pension.
